Noyce doing Above Suspicion? Yes, but…

nullThe trades reported today Phil Noyce is attached to direct a flick titled “Above Suspicion” – about the only FBI agent to be convicted of murder. Sounds interesting. Thing is, it’s not the done deal we’re told it is. Seems the announcement was a tad premature.

“As sometimes happens the production company have taken a development deal and placed it in the trades”, a long-time and reliable source told Moviehole. “There is no deal for Noyce to direct “Above Suspicion” and not even a tentative start date.Certainly not the fall of 2009,when Noyce will be in the middle of editing SALT for Sony”.

Even then, Noyce has two other films he’s looking to do after “Salt”, the thriller starring Angelina Jolie, he’s shooting early next year. They “Moral Hazard” for Spitfire Films and “Dirt Music” possibly with Russell Crowe*, through Noyce’s own Australian production company.

* Yep, Crowe is in talks to do Noyce’s long-gestating “Dirt Music” – a film the late, great Heath Ledger was once onboard. The movie is an adaptation of the Tim Winton novel about a couple in a loveless relationship and is set in a remote fishing village on the West Australian coast.
